The following Frameworks, Libraries and Tools were used during the development of this site and I would like to thank the developers for giving their time and skill for the greater good.


  • Logo Font is from tenbytwenty. I loved the simple and bold styling.
  • Inkscape and GIMP - I am no designer. But I did do all the graphics styling for this site. GIMP is the best and easy to use free open source tool for graphics editing. And Inkscape is my favourite free and open source vector graphics editor. These two in combination make for excellent package.
  • Bing API - This project uses the soap web service version of the api and is fast, flexible and a delight to use. Using this api, the user is able to search a focused set of quality hand picked resources.
  • delicious API and Delicious.Net (C#.NET Wrapper) - This project uses the delicious api to collect, classify and sync resources. Without which the project would have taken considerable longer time.
  • LinqKit - This is the missing feature set from the Entity Framework. And I use LinqKit as a default in all my projects using the Entity Framework.
  • MVCContrib - This makes ASP.Net MVC so much more fun to use.
  • StructureMap - My favourite Dependency Injection / Inversion of Control tool.
  • Elmah - This is a Error Logging Module and Handler. It has more options and database support than you would ever need.
